Pueblo’s ‘Little Jewelbox’ Temple Emanuel celebrates 125 years

Temple Emanuel, a synagogue on the north side of Pueblo, has stood for 125 years as a testament to the local Jewish community's resilience.

The congregation believes strongly that the temple is not only the synagogue for the Jewish community, but it also belongs to the citizens of Pueblo.

The synagogue, known as the “Little Jewelbox,” features a stunning Star of David in a stained glass window, surrounded by radiant beams of color. The temple recently celebrated Simchat Torah with joyful songs and dance, marking the cycle of Torah readings.
